Schwarzenegger Picks Conservative for Agriculture, Liberal Might lead EPA

California-s Republican Governor-elect made another major appointment today, that of Secretary of Food and Agriculture. AG Kawamura is an Orange County strawberry farmer with ties to Agribusiness. Sources involved in putting together the new administration say that Schwarzenegger will name environmentalist Terry Tamminen as Secretary of Environmental Protection. We get response to the newest cabinet selections, and ask a Conservative Republican who had doubts about Schwarzenegger if he-s disappointed or pleased. Making News: State Cuts Impact Californian-s Everyday Lives Budget cuts are already beginning in California as Governor Gray Davis implements the Legislative mandate to reduce this year-s spending by $1.1 billion. John Hill, state budget reporter for the Sacramento Bee, details several of the services being cut through layoffs, cancellation of temporary contracts and the elimination of vacant positions. Reporter-s Notebook: The Foster Care System Foster care often means multiple families and a life of changes for young people. Alan Eyeree Reyes of Youth Radio LA offers a very different perspective.
